Coral Pink is a delicate, light pink with warm yellow-red undertones. This warm shade has an LRV of 49 and absorbs a moderate amount of light, making it versatile for a variety of spaces.
Coral Pink (2-6) by Pratt & Lambert is a warm pink with warm yellow-red undertones. Its hex code is #E7ACA9 and it has an LRV of 49, making it a medium light color. It is suitable for both interior and exterior use.

What is the hex code for Coral Pink 2-6?
The hex code for Pratt & Lambert Coral Pink (2-6) is #E7ACA9.
What is the LRV of Coral Pink?
Coral Pink (2-6) has an LRV (Light Reflectance Value) of 49, which is classified as medium light. LRV ranges from 0 (pure black) to 100 (pure white).
Is Coral Pink warm or cool?
Coral Pink (2-6) is a warm color with warm yellow-red undertones.

What is the RGB value of Coral Pink?
The RGB value of Pratt & Lambert Coral Pink (2-6) is R:231, G:172, B:169. The hex code is #E7ACA9.
Can Coral Pink be used on exteriors?
Yes, Coral Pink (2-6) is rated for both interior and exterior use.
